Significance of Enzymatic process
Enzymatic process refers to biochemical reactions that are facilitated by enzymes, playing a crucial role in metabolism and the interaction of drugs. These processes are essential for various life functions and contribute to how substances are processed within living organisms. Understanding enzymatic processes is vital for advancements in fields such as biochemistry and pharmacology, as they influence both normal biological functions and therapeutic applications.
